>> Hello,
>> 
>> I mantain a repository of the current Fedora packages for all Fedora 
>> supported distributions (RHEL/CentOS 5/6, Fedora 16/17/18) at:
>> 
>> http://repos.fedorapeople.org/repos/slaanesh/bacula/
>> 
>> They are the same that are in Fedora 17/18/rawhide, they contain the latest 
>> 5.2.12 and the package will 99% be the one in RHEL 7.
>> 
>> To only install the client; just issue a "yum install bacula-client"
>> 
>> Any constructive feedback is appreciated, but please read the enclosed 
>> README files which tell you how to configure the correct SQL backend with 
>> the alternatives system.
>> 
>> http://repos.fedorapeople.org/repos/slaanesh/bacula/README.txt
>> 
>> The git repositories with the spec file and eventual patches are at:
>> 
>> http://pkgs.fedoraproject.org/cgit/bacula.git/
>> http://pkgs.fedoraproject.org/cgit/bacula-docs.git/
